Nombre

svn move — Mover un fichero o directorio.

Sinopsis

svn move SRC DST

Descripción

Este comando mueve un fichero o directorio en su copia local de trabajo o en el repositorio.

[Sugerencia] Sugerencia

Este comando es equivalente a un svn copy seguido de un svn delete.

[Nota] Nota

Subversion no soporta operaciones de movimiento entre copias locales y URLs. Adicionalmente, sólo puede mover ficheros dentro de un único repositorio—Subversion no soporta movimientos entre repositorios.

WC -> WC

Mueve y programa un fichero o directorio para que sea añadido (con historia).

URL -> URL

Renombrado que se realiza por completo en el lado del servidor.

Nombres alternativos

mv, rename, ren

Cambios

Copia local de trabajo, repositorio si opera sobre una URL

Accede al repositorio

Sólo si opera sobre una URL

Parámetros

--message (-m) TEXT
--file (-F) FILE
--revision (-r) REV
--quiet (-q)
--force
--username USER
--password PASS
--no-auth-cache
--non-interactive
--editor-cmd EDITOR
--encoding ENC
--force-log
--config-dir DIR

Ejemplos

Mover un fichero en su copia local de trabajo:

$ svn move foo.c bar.c
A         bar.c
D         foo.c

Mover un fichero en el repositorio (el cambio es inmediato, por lo que se requiere un mensaje de informe de cambios):

$ svn move -m "Move a file" http://svn.red-bean.com/repos/foo.c \
                            http://svn.red-bean.com/repos/bar.c

Committed revision 27.